In the vast library of biblical commentaries, few works achieve the dual status of theological depth and devotional warmth. Among these, William R. Newell’s Romans Verse by Verse stands as a monument to early 20th-century dispensational theology. Written by a man who was both a scholar and a pastor, this commentary on the Apostle Paul’s magnum opus has guided countless believers through the dense forest of justification, sanctification, and sovereignty. Newell’s work is not merely an academic exercise; it is a passionate, verse-by-verse plea for the reader to understand the grace of God as revealed in Romans.
